You can't get much more "Classic San Francisco" than Tommy's Joynt restaurant. Tommy's Joynt opened its doors in 1947 and immediately shaped up as an eatery and watering hole for the city's glitterati, including Herb Caen, Senator Diane Feinstein and opera star Juusie Bjoerling. It has survived earthquakes and fires and has since become as much a hallmark of San Francisco life as Alcatraz, the Cable Cars and Fisherman's Wharf. Over the years, it has been a favorite must-visit spot for tourists and natives alike. Like "Cheers" of TV Fame, it's a place where people can meet and watch sports TV, or just talk over an ice-cold beer. And, if you're a regular, there's a good chance that everybody knows your name! It pioneered the "Hofbrau" style in San Francisco, an atmosphere where it's friendly, warm, the walls covered in memorabilia, and the food is simply great.
